After finishing your delicious breakfast, you will depart for a three-hour journey to Alexandria with our skilful guide by private A/C vehicle. You will admire the majestic monument of Pompay Pillar; it was established in the honor of Emperor Diocletian. Continue to the Citadel of Sultan Quitbay, built on the same spot of the ancient lighthouse of Alexandria. Then you will visit the Catacombs of Kom El Shokafa, it is the largest Roman Cemetery consisting of 3 levels cut in the rock underground tunnel that shows the merge between Roman and Egyptian art. Afterward, you will visit the famous library of Alexandria and the Montazah Palace gardens of King Farouk. You will have the opportunity to take some impressive and unique photos at Alexandria. The best time to visit Egypt is during the cooler months of October to April when temperatures are more comfortable for exploring the historical sites. However, if you're interested in diving in the Red Sea, the summer months offer warm waters and excellent visibility.
When visiting religious sites such as mosques or temples, it's important to dress modestly out of respect. Both men and women should have their shoulders and knees covered. It's also advisable for women to carry a scarf to cover their hair if needed.
